This book provides a comprehensive analysis of Squatter problems in Kenya. It examines the magnitude and nature of problem of squatters in the study area. The book also analyses the major social and economic factors related to the squatter migration and settlement in the context of Uasin Gishu District and suggests ways and means of managing the situation. This book is recommended for policy makers and development agencies seeking to minimize squatter problems in Kenya. Students of Sociology of Urbanization and Urban planning and management will find the book very useful.
